Especificações
| Atributo | Valor |
| Package | Tray |
| ProductStatus | Active |
| Type | Clock Generator, Fanout Distribution |
| PLL | Yes |
| Input | Clock |
| Output | CMOS, LVDS, LVPECL |
| NumberofCircuits | 1 |
| Ratio-Input:Output | 1:14 |
| Differential-Input:Output | Yes/Yes |
| Frequency-Max | 2.95GHz |
| Divider/Multiplier | Yes/No |
| Voltage-Supply | 3.135V ~ 3.465V |
| OperatingTemperature | -40°C ~ 85°C |
| MountingType | Surface Mount |
| Package/Case | 64-VFQFN Exposed Pad, CSP |

Description
The AD9516-3BCPZ supports an external VCXO/TCXO for applications requiring higher frequency stability. It also includes a programmable output divider, phase synchronization, and skew adjustment features, enhancing its capability to meet precise timing requirements. The device is configured via a serial interface, enabling easy integration into digital systems. It is available in a compact package, making it suitable for space-constrained designs. Overall, the AD9516-3BCPZ is a versatile solution for clock management in complex electronic systems, balancing high performance with configurability.

Features
1. Clock Outputs: It offers 14 LVPECL outputs, which can be configured for various signal standards.
2. Frequency Range: The device supports a wide frequency range, suitable for various applications.
3. Divider Functionality: It includes dividers that allow flexible clocking options to meet specific needs.
4. Low Jitter Performance: The device is designed to deliver low jitter clock signals, crucial for high-speed and precise applications.
5. Programmability: It offers extensive programmable features, accessible via a serial interface, to tailor the device's performance to specific requirements.
6. Power Supply: Operates on a 3.3V power supply, ensuring compatibility with standard digital logic levels.
7. Temperature Range: Supports industrial temperature ranges, making it suitable for robust applications.
8. Package: The device is available in a compact, space-saving package, ideal for dense circuit designs.
These features make the AD9516-3BCPZ suitable for applications requiring precise clock distribution, such as telecommunications and data communications systems.
Pinout
The primary function of the AD9516-3 is to provide clock distribution with low jitter and phase noise. It features multiple clock outputs, phase-locked loop (PLL) capabilities, and the ability to generate various frequencies from a single reference input. The device is versatile, offering programmable dividers, phase adjustability, and delay adjustments, making it suitable for synchronizing various components in a system with high precision.
The AD9516-3 serves in applications like digital communication systems, instrumentation, and data conversion systems where clock integrity is crucial.
